Job Description

We are seeking an experienced and highly skilled Senior Audio Engineer with a specialization in L-Acoustics systems. The ideal candidate will have extensive experience working with L-Acoustics sound systems in live events and will be responsible for the design, setup, operation, and maintenance of the audio systems for one of our client venues. This role is crucial in ensuring the highest quality sound production for events ranging from concerts to corporate events.

Responsibilities :

  • System Design & Setup : Design, configure, and set up L-Acoustics audio systems tailored to the venue’s acoustics and event requirements.

  • Sound Mixing & Tuning : Handle live sound mixing, ensuring optimal sound clarity, volume, and balance for every event. Utilize L-Acoustics network control software (e.g., LA Network Manager) for tuning and system optimization.

  • System Maintenance : Perform regular maintenance and checks on all audio equipment, ensuring L-Acoustics systems are in optimal condition for all events.

  • Collaboration : Work closely with event producers, technical directors, and artists to understand their audio needs and provide solutions for sound design, coverage, and technical support.

  • Troubleshooting : Quickly and effectively troubleshoot and resolve any technical issues that arise with the audio systems, especially during live performances or events.

  • Equipment Inventory : Manage the inventory of all in-house audio equipment, ensuring the availability of necessary gear and assisting with the procurement of additional equipment when required.

  • Team Leadership & Training : Lead and mentor junior audio engineers and technicians, ensuring the team has the necessary knowledge and skills to operate the systems effectively. Provide training on L-Acoustics equipment and audio engineering best practices.

  • Event Support : Be present on event days for setup, sound checks, and operation of audio systems, ensuring everything runs smoothly during live events.

Requirements

  • Expertise in L-Acoustics : Proven experience working with L-Acoustics audio systems, including loudspeakers, amplifiers, and network control software. Knowledge of L-Acoustics modeling tools (e.g., Soundvision) is a plus.
  • Extensive Audio Engineering Experience : Minimum 5 years of experience working as an audio engineer, with a strong background in live sound reinforcement, system design, and mixing for large-scale events.
  • Technical Proficiency : In-depth understanding of sound system components, signal flow, acoustics, and digital mixing consoles (e.g., Avid, Yamaha).
  • Strong Problem-Solving Skills : Ability to troubleshoot audio issues quickly and effectively, especially under pressure during live events.
  • Excellent Communication : Strong communication and interpersonal skills, with the ability to work collaboratively with artists, event organizers, and technical teams.
  • Detail-Oriented : High attention to detail, especially when calibrating and tuning sound systems.
  • Flexible Schedule : Ability to work evenings, weekends, and irregular hours as required by the event schedule.

Preferred Qualifications :

  • Certification or training in L-Acoustics products and systems.

  • Experience in a venue-based or permanent audio engineering role.

  • Knowledge of audio software, such as Pro Tools, QLab, or other sound-related applications.

  • Familiarity with other sound systems and brands in addition to L-Acoustics.
